Woman Left Permanently Disfigured After Childhood Friend Slashes Her Face With Wine Glass For Smiling


Story out of Sheffield, England:

A 25-year-old was left scarred for life when she was glassed by a woman because she smiled at her.

Rosie Skitt was attacked by 20-year-old Charlotte Green who accused the victim of looking at her in a 'sarcastic way.'

But Rosie said she recognised her attacker from her sister's football team when they were younger, and that she smiled across the bar 'to say hello.'

A court heard that Green then confronted sales administrator Rosie, asking 'do you have a problem with me?' before striking her with the wine glass.

Rosie, who needs further operations on her face, faced her attacker in court and told the hearing how she still suffers flashbacks and has to wear special camouflage make-up to conceal her scars.

Green, of Sheffield, initially pleaded not guilty to GBH with intent, which can carry a life sentence and was due to stand trial, but the prosecution accepted a lesser charge of GBH, which she admitted.

Dermot Hughes, representing the attacker, said she was remorseful and had found it difficult to come to terms with what she had done. Cont.
